favian
Hi. I'd like to host some WAP content that is not available for public viewing and can only be retrieved by a specific WAP gateway. Can someone tell me how that can be done? Thanks very much.
Vanya
WAP uses http so you can use .htaccess for denying an access.

http://httpd.apache.org/docs/mod/mod_access.html
Read there:
Directives
Allow
Deny
Order

You'll need to use Allow,Deny order and to Allow needed WAP gateways.
